My Kitchen Assistant

Reimagining the modern day sous-chef by integrating recipes and skills into an Amazon Echo Show application” 

Overview

Class: Digital Product Design (ENTR 390)
Objective“Enhance the Cooking Experience”
SkillsUser Research, UX/UI Design, Prototyping
Interface: Amazon Echo Show 2nd Generation
Tools: Adobe XD

Problem Statement

Beginner cooks want a more intuitive and enjoyable way to prepare meals and enhance their cooking skills.

Process

The biggest challenge I faced with this project was attempting to seamlessly integrate voice and touch features in a way that would make it a gain for the busy home cooks and not a pain for users to understand. I began my brainstorming process by identifying key elements for a voice-based cooking and recipe app. This process involved contextual inquiry via observations, surveys, and interviews. From my contextual inquiry, I created an affinity map, which highlights the scope and features of my brainstorm.  ​​​​​​​

Affinity Map

One important note I made during affinity mapping was that many of the participants in the initial inquiry said that they were too busy during the day to spend time cooking. I knew there was a way in my app to still appeal to these users, so I decided to implement a timer and a filter in my recipes so that people who just want to make a quick fix can do so. Also, I can consider creating a meal plan/prep section that includes multiple servings of a meal to allow for the busy persona to prepare in advance for the busy week.​​​​​​​

Personas and Scenarios

Primary Persona and Scenario: Natalie

Secondary Personas and Scenarios: Charles and Amy

Wireframes

I began creating wireframes once I defined my personas and scenarios. I wanted to ensure users have the ability to filter ingredients and dietary restrictions because many of my contextual inquiry participants mentioned their dietary lifestyles (as seen in Amy’s persona and scenario). Here’s a snippet of my wireframes:

Final Mockup and Prototype

After I received feedback on my low fidelity wireframes, I needed to quickly create a functional prototype. I attempted to use some of the auto-animate features (such as the bookmark and timer) and therefore I created my designs and prototypes with only Adobe XD. Attached below is a video of the interaction, and I made sure to incorporate both voice and text UI for a more flexible and enjoyable experience.

Note: Long pauses in video represent voice commands that were not captured by a microphone. If video is not playing, click this link.

Close Menu